What is an HSM? Why It’s Critical for Data Security 

 

A Hardware Security Module (HSM) is a highly secure, tamper-resistant device that protects encryption keys, performs cryptographic operations, and ensures secure data processing. 

In simpler terms: 

An HSM is the brain of your encryption strategy. It secures, processes, and protects thousands of transactions per second.

Can a single Futurex Hardware Security Module (HSM) serve multiple applications or departments?

Yes. Through Hardware Security Module (HSM) virtualization, our devices can operate as up to 75 logically isolated virtual HSMs, each with separate key stores, firmware, and configurations. This allows you to securely segment cryptographic functions across departments, tenants, or use cases—all within one physical HSM.

What kind of key management capabilities do Futurex Hardware Security Modules (HSMs) provide?

We offer full-spectrum key lifecycle management—from secure key generation and storage to rotation, archival, and retirement. For payment environments, our Hardware Security Modules (HSMs) handle EMV key generation, mobile token issuance, PIN verification, and remote key loading. We also support BYOK (Bring Your Own Key) and cloud key management, all while maintaining compliance and operational efficiency.

What integration tools does Futurex provide for developers and IT teams?

We provide comprehensive developer support, including vendor-neutral APIs, SDKs, and scripting libraries like the Futurex Client Library (FXCL) and FXCLI. You can integrate our HSMs with platforms like Oracle, Microsoft, VMware, and Check Point, or build custom applications using common libraries such as PKCS #11 and Java. Our web-based GUI and remote tools like Excrypt Touch make configuration and key loading intuitive and efficient.
